Philosophy of biology educator
Manier, August Edward was born on April 7, 1931 in Versailles, Ohio, United States. Son of Francis Vitalis and Whilma Anna (Grillot) Manier.
Bachelor of Science with high honors, University Notre Dame, 1953. Doctor of Philosophy, St. Louis University, 1961.
Lecturer, Webster College, Webster Groves, Missouri, 1956-1959; instructor philosophy of biology, U. Notre Dame, Indiana, 1959-1961; assistant professor, U. Notre Dame, Indiana, 1961-1967; associate professor, U. Notre Dame, Indiana, 1967-1988; professor, U. Notre Dame, Indiana, since 1988. National Endowment for Humanities visiting fellow Cambridge (England) University, 1971-1972.
Precinct committeeman South Bend (Indiana) Democratic Committee, 1970-1980. President Woods and Wedge Neighborhood Association, South Bend, 1975-1977, East Side Little League Baseball, 1981-1983. Member American Association for the Advancement of Science (secretary history and philosophy of science since 1989), American Philosophical Association, Philosophy of Science Association, History of Science Society, Society for Social Studies of Science.
Married Dorothy Frances Hickey, June 18, 1955 (divorced June 1983). Children: Michael, David, Maureen, August Edward Junior, John, Daniel, Jeremy. Married Jenny Ann Pitts, October 18, 1985.
